Community Outreach Representative

Reports to: Community Outreach Manager

FLSA Status: Non-Exempt

Position Summary

The Community Outreach Representative supports Nuvia Medical’s mission to transform the health of communities by transforming healthcare. Guided by our values — ICARE = Integrity, Compassion, Accountability, Respect, Excellence — this role engages directly with community members, patients, and partner organizations to increase awareness of Nuvia services, assist with health plan enrollment, and connect individuals to ACCESS Centers. The Community Outreach Representative serves as a frontline ambassador, ensuring respectful, compassionate interactions and driving access to care in underserved communities.

Essential Duties & ResponsibilitiesCommunity Engagement

  • Represent Nuvia Medical at health fairs, community events, and partner meetings.
  • Build relationships with community leaders, organizations, and healthcare providers.
  • Promote awareness of Nuvia’s mission, services, and ACCESS Centers.

Enrollment & Patient Support

  • Assist individuals with health plan applications and enrollment processes.
  • Provide education on available services and connect patients to resources.
  • Ensure a welcoming, supportive environment for all community members.

Access Center Support

  • Greet visitors, answer questions, and support front-line operations at ACCESS Centers.
  • Collaborate with Center Administrators and staff to ensure smooth processes.
  • Track and document outreach, applications, and follow-up interactions.

Compliance & Reporting

  • Meet established performance metrics for outreach contacts, applications, and enrollments.
  • Maintain accurate records of activities and submit required reports.
  • Adhere to HIPAA standards and all Nuvia Medical policies and procedures.

Qualifications

  • High school diploma or equivalent required; associate’s or bachelor’s degree in social work, public health, or related field preferred.
  • 1–2 years of experience in community outreach, customer service, healthcare access, or related field.
  • Bilingual (English/Spanish or English/Creole) strongly preferred.
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ills with the ability to build trust quickly.
  • Customer service orientation with empathy and problem-solving skills.
  • Ability to work evenings/weekends for events and travel locally as needed.
  • Basic proficiency with Microsoft Office and data entry systems.
  • Familiarity with healthcare systems, social services, or managed care organizations preferred.

Compensation

Minimum: $45,000

Midpoint: $50,000

Maximum: $55,000
